
North Elizabeth Neighborhood Guide
Runway Views, Valença, 1&9 Grit.
🧭Generally defined as the area: north of Morris Avenue and West Grand Street, south of the Newark city line and the Newark Liberty International Airport fence along Haynes Avenue, east of the Elizabeth River and Cherry Street, and west of Dowd Avenue, the New Jersey Turnpike 13A complex, and US 1 and 9 Truck
